Toddler Hospitalized After Nearly Drowning In Northridge Pool
NORTHRIDGE (CBS) — A toddler was hospitalized Thursday after he nearly drowned in a backyard swimming pool.
Firefighters responded to a call from the 8700 block of Corbin Avenue just before 8:30 a.m.
Paramedics helped restore the boy's breathing before he was airlifted to a hospital, Los Angeles Fire Department spokesman Rich Matheney said.
The circumstances of the near-drowning were under investigation.
The boy's mother was at the residence, and the child was out of the water when firefighters arrived, Matheney said.
